Sesame Beef and Broccoli Stir-Fry
Thinly sliced flank steak and crisp broccoli florets are flash-seared in a hot wok with aromatic ginger and a savory sesame-tamari glaze.

PREPARATION
Thinly slice the flank steak against the grain into bite-sized strips and set aside.
Steam the broccoli florets for 2 minutes until bright green and slightly tender, then drain and set aside.
Heat the avocado oil in a large wok or skillet over high heat until shimmering.
Add the beef strips in a single layer and sear for 1-2 minutes until browned, then flip and cook for another minute.
Reduce heat to medium-high and stir in the minced garlic, grated ginger, and red pepper flakes, cooking for 30 seconds until fragrant.
Add the steamed broccoli, tamari, and toasted sesame oil to the pan, tossing everything together for 1 minute to coat.
Remove from heat and garnish with sesame seeds before serving.
